Key Locations

Discover the captivating allure of the key locations along the 7 Day Peak Trek in Pokhara, each offering unique perspectives of the Annapurna and Dhaulagiri mountain ranges.

Ghorepani Poon Hill provides stunning sunrise views over the majestic Annapurna and Dhaulagiri peaks, making it a prime spot for photography enthusiasts.

Tadapani Hill offers mesmerizing views of surrounding peaks and lush forests, ideal for wildlife encounters and immersive cultural experiences.

Mulde Hill boasts panoramic vistas of the Annapurna range and Machhapuchhre, a perfect spot for capturing breathtaking moments.

Ghandruk Hill showcases well-preserved traditional houses and a rich Gurung culture, providing an opportunity for culture.

Lastly, Mohare Hill, nestled between the Annapurna and Dhaulagiri mountains, offers a unique perspective of the gorge and opportunities to savor local cuisine.

What Kind of Accommodation Can Be Expected During the Trek?

During the trek, trekkers will stay in cozy tea houses along the trail. These accommodations offer basic facilities and warm hospitality. Meals provided are typically local dishes. Hygiene standards may vary, so it’s advisable to bring personal hygiene items.

Are There Any Cultural Customs or Etiquette That Trekkers Should Be Aware Of?

Trekker etiquette in Nepal involves removing shoes before entering homes, using the right hand for gestures, and avoiding public displays of affection. Respect local customs like greeting with "Namaste." Embrace cultural customs by learning about traditional dress and participating in local rituals.
